About the Team
Within Technology, Data & Analytics our Financial Services practice is the UK’s leading data and technology team where you will have extensive opportunities to work with the largest and most influential financial services clients in the UK and Globally. We utilise leading edge data and technology capabilities to help our clients deal with a number of challenges around data, data management, regulatory reporting, data transformation, cloud, ESG etc all underpinned by a deep set of skills around data and data analytics.
The role
Risk management and compliance in Financial Services (“FS”) continues to be in the top three priorities for advisory spend and PwC are market leaders in supporting our clients in this space.
Our FS clients are driven by the need to further accelerate their risk and compliance transformation as a result of (a) market, (b) client and (c) regulatory pressures - all of which are impacted by the post-pandemic recovery, digital disruption and geopolitical uncertainty. You will be joining a team which leads in supporting our FS clients with Risk and Compliance related challenges. Specifically, through technology and data enablement, we are looking to enhance the way we offer our services to our clients to help them overcome complex regulatory and operational challenges.
The essentials
You will have experience of the unique complexity of the Risk and Compliance landscape within the Financial Services sector driven by regulation, global operations and legacy business. This will enable you to help solve our clients’ challenges through the use of technology and data analytics, focussing on the use of an array of delivery models and data-led methodologies. The candidate will have experience with driving the development of technology enabled assets and taking these to market across the FS sector.
Key Responsibilities:
Lead the ideation and development of technology and data enabled assets to solve our clients’ challenges
Lead complex client engagements, engaging with senior stakeholders and regulators to solve problems in the Risk and Compliance space
Deliver added value to clients by providing knowledge, ideas and solutions for improving their management of Risk and Compliance
Integrate and embed a strong culture of technology and data-led thinking, supporting risk reduction and enabling rapid business insights, transformation and innovation
Ability to lead engagements and teams to deliver against key requirements
Manage delivery, and support the development of diverse and hybrid teams
Demonstrate strong written and verbal communication to provide a clear articulation of policy and strategy, to report recommendations and engage with key stakeholders across both business and technology
Proactively assist in the delivery of business change and conduct risk transformation projects, which may include managing several concurrent client programmes, reporting progress to Senior Managers and above.
Develop strategies to solve complex technical challenges, help firms to rethink their approach to risk and control and work with our clients to create robust and sustainable change.
Build and maintain effective working relationships with clients and help identify opportunities to broaden relationships with new and existing clients.
Keep up to date with significant economic challenges and contribute to the development of your team’s technical acumen.
Additional Job Description
Preferred Skills
Experience within Financial Services
Experience within Risk and Compliance
Experience with development and management of technology enabled assets
Experience in some, or all of the following proposition areas: Model Validation, Consumer Duty, Trading / Front Office Risk, FS Compliance, Regulatory Reporting
